Parasocial interaction was 1st described from the point of view of media and interaction scientific tests. In 1956, Horton and Wohl explored the different interactions between mass media people and media figures and identified the existence of the parasocial relationship (PSR), where the person functions as though They can be linked to a typical social relationship.
